A lightweight cotton crewneck that feels like a warm morning—soft against skin, breathable, and built to layer. The front wears a small, hand-drawn sun at the chest for a quiet nod to daylight. On the back, an artistic scene unfolds: a bold letter A framed by sunbeams and drifting clouds with a seated figure, giving the sweater a storybook, reflective vibe. The relaxed fit and smooth ring-spun cotton make it easy to wear from coffee runs to sunset walks. Subtle construction details—ribbed cuffs and hem, shoulder and neck twill tape, and a tubular knit—keep the silhouette clean and comfortable while holding the print beautifully.



Product features


- 100% ring-spun cotton — smooth, strong print surface


- Lightweight fabric (6.4 oz/yd²) — breathable and layerable


- 1x1 ribbed cuffs & hem — stretch and recovery for a neat fit


- Tubular knit (no side seams) & shoulder/neck twill — stable shape and reduced waste


- Relaxed fit with sewn-in twill label — comfortable, adult sizing
